Wins 3 of 6 | Nutrient | Arrowroot Flour | Buckwheat groats, roasted, cooked |
|---|---|---|
| Calories (kcal) | 357 | 92 |
| Protein (g) | 0.3 | 3.38 |
| Fat (g) | 0.1 | 0.62 |
| Carbs (g) | 88.15 | 19.94 |
| Fiber (g) | 3.4 | 2.7 |
| Potassium (mg) | 11 | 88 |
